| Ubuntu 14.04 LTS x86-64 | Operating system | | | Ubuntu 14.04 LTS x86-64 | Operating system | | ||
| 2 GB RAM, 10 GB disk space | Minimum system requirements | | | 2 GB RAM, 10 GB disk space | Minimum system requirements | | ||
- | | http://apt.roksnet.com/xroad6-debs | RoksNet package repository | | + | | http://x-road.eu/packages | X-Road package repository | |
- | | http://apt.roksnet.com/xroad6-debs/roksnet_repo.gpg | The repository key | | + | | http://x-road.eu/packages/xroad_repo.gpg | The repository key | |
| TCP 5500 | Port inbound & outbound for message exchange between security servers | | | TCP 5500 | Port inbound & outbound for message exchange between security servers | | ||
| TCP 5577 | Port inbound & outbound for querying OCSP responses between security servers | | | TCP 5577 | Port inbound & outbound for querying OCSP responses between security servers | | ||
